Regular Season Round 4: Obras - Olimpico 118-55
Date: October 8, 2025
Not a big story in a game in Buenos Aires where bottom-rankedOlimpico (0-3) was rolled over by top-ranked Obras (3-0) 118-55 on Wednesday. Obras dominated down low during the game scoring 68 of its points in the paint compared to Olimpico 's 42. Obras forced 21 Olimpico turnovers and outrebounded them 52-24 including a 19-7 advantage in offensive rebounds. Obras looked well-organized offensively handing out 33 assists comparing to just 14 passes made by Olimpico 's players. Power forward Valentino Finetti (204-2005) fired a double-double by scoring 18 points and 10 rebounds (on 7-of-9 shooting from the field) for the winners. Joaquin Lopez (205-2005) chipped in 17 points and 6 rebounds. Five Obras players scored in double figures. Obras' coach felt very confident that he used 11 players and allowed the starting five to rest. point guard Gian Rossi (185-2005) produced 14 points and power forward Martin Chapero (205-2007) added 9 points and 5 rebounds respectively for lost side. Obras have a solid three-game winning streak. They moved-up to second place, which they share with La Union. Loser Olimpico still closes the standings with three games lost. They share the position with San Martin. Obras will meet Argentino (#5) in the next round. Olimpico will play against Gimnasia (#10) in Comodoro Rivadavia and looks forward to get finally their first victory.
